"'Surface observation of a single cell cumulonimbus' is the
scientific description for the phenomena observed in the work 'Rorschach Clouds'. Cloud observation from the ground is generally understood to be more subjective in nature by scientists than the remote view of satellite imaging or digital logging of weather data.
The decay of a single cell cumulonimbus cloud is rapid and they seldom exist for more than half an hour. The complex dynamical system of clouds also has parallels with generative data processing.
The audio track is a single tone which alters automatically depending on how much ‘blue’ is present in the video image. The cloud movement also generates changes in the tone."
